rkkwan Feb 20th, 2008 10:54 AM

Fastest way to CMH, with a semi-probable connection at LAX is on AA. Departs LAX 2:00p, arrives DFW 7:00p; then departs DFW 8:10p and arrives CMH 11:30p.

Or UA departs LAX also 2:00p, connect at ORD and arrives CMH 11:35p.

To give yourself a little more time at LAX, DL departs 2:15p, connect at ATL, and arrives CMH 12:05a.

UA departs 2:20p, connect at DEN, also arrives CMH 12:05a.

If you're interlining, then DL to DEN at 2:45p, and UA to CMH, arriving 12:05a.

I don't think there are faster ways. Even if you're willing to use alternate airports.
